Charges filed against Ogdensburg man in deadly accident involving Amish buggy

A man from Ogdensburg, aged 34, was arrested by New York State Police in connection to a crash in 2023 involving an Amish buggy in Oswegatchie, New York. The incident led to the death of one person and serious injuries to another. The man, identified as Clark Zanker, faces charges of criminally negligent homicide and third-degree assault. The crash occurred on State Route 812, involving a horse-drawn Amish buggy and a pickup truck. Tragically, the crash resulted in the death of 21-year-old Abraham Shetler and severe injuries to 19-year-old Joseph Yoder. Zanker allegedly struck the buggy from behind, causing the passengers to be thrown from the vehicle. Zanker was released on his own recognizance after being arraigned in Gouverneur Court.
